Bruce Dethlefsen was born to Frank and Patricia Dethlefsen in 1948. Bruce lived in Kansas City with his family until 1966. Frank worked as a grocer. According to Bruce, his father wanted him to attend college, but was not keen on Bruce's desire to be a poet, as he did not think it practical.

Asked how poems come to him, Dethlefsen says, “They float by in the air and I catch them. If I’m not paying attention, they go on by. That’s the most important thing for poets, to pay attention. Listen, watch, regard. Artists must pay close attention.”

Dethlefsen resides in Westfield, Wisconsin with longtime love and partner, Sue Allen. Bruce also had a son, Wilson, now deceased.
